Recently, I have communicated with many application developers and found that they have many problems: the fragmentation of Android devices makes it difficult to adapt to applications, it is difficult to call up device capabilities in imaging and AI, the lack of operational tools, and there is no good way to monetize them.
Is there a way to solve these pain points? On October 27, in the application service session of the 2021 OPPO Developer Conference, it can be clearly seen that the continuously evolving OPPO mobile service platform is breaking these pain points with "addition, subtraction, multiplication and division" to help developers better enter the new era of "integration of all things".

Addition: The system engine fuels the application experience
When we use some apps, we may have the experience that the phone's camera is very well advertised, but the photos taken with an app are of poor quality. The reason for this is that the application cannot call up the imaging capabilities of the device itself well, which creates a gap between the imaging capabilities of the system and the third-party applications.
The open system engine of oppo's mobile service platform is born for similar problems. According to Han Hui, product manager of OPPO development platform, OPPO has opened up many system engines, including Hyper Boost, CameraUnit, ARUnit, MediaUnit, GalleryUnit, Link Boost, CarLink, etc., opening up the system's CPU, imaging, multimedia, network capabilities, etc. to developers to do "addition" for the application experience.
Taking CameraUnit as an example, developers can obtain powerful imaging capabilities such as dual camera and open, HDR, super image stabilization, super night scene, ultra wide angle, SAT zoom shooting, etc., so that their applications can also achieve the same shooting effect as OPPO cameras. For example, dual camera is open, developers can obtain the ability to preview two Camera data at the same time through CameraUnit, explore the innovative gameplay of picture-in-picture, expand the theme + ultra-wide angle, front + rear and other perspectives at the same time, bringing users a rich shooting experience.
And CameraUnit, which has so many powerful capabilities, has a lightweight package body, only 20KB, and application developers only need to simply configure the corresponding capability parameters to complete the access. It is understood that at present, applications such as Douyin and Kuaishou have accessed the relevant capabilities of CameraUnit, which can use the system's native multi-source sensor information fusion and anti-shake scene intelligent analysis to bring users a better experience.
The experience of other system engines is similar, such as Hyper Boost can improve the application experience from the whole process of running, displaying, and operating; MediaUnit can solve the pain points of video playback often encountered by third-party applications, and get a richer and better experience in vision and hearing; AI Boost can help developers easily integrate rich AI capabilities and algorithms into the APP to maximize application performance...
It can be seen that the OPPO mobile service platform is like a super connector, connecting the powerful technical capabilities accumulated by OPPO on the one end, connecting the applications of developers at the other end, and doing "addition" for applications through the opening and empowerment of capabilities, so that applications have a better experience.
Subtraction: Say goodbye to the development adaptation puzzle
In terms of development and adaptation, developers have many problems: application compatibility problems caused by fragmentation of Android mobile devices; cumbersome application user registration process and difficulty in obtaining customers. The OPPO mobile service platform does "subtraction" for developers and intimately helps them solve these problems.
For example, OPPO provides remote real machine and automated testing services to help developers solve the problem of application compatibility under device fragmentation. Log on to OPPO's cloud test platform, not only the model is comprehensive, a network to play a variety of OPPO new and old models, but also open the web page to carry out real mobile phone environment operations, provide screenshots and real-time logs, improve the efficiency of adaptation. More importantly, it can also provide compatibility, stability, performance of automated test solutions for OPPO mobile phones, and quickly find problems.
In the process of the official release of Android 12, the OPPO open platform to help developers adapt efficiently has attracted attention. From the release of the first beta version, the OPPO open platform closely follows the iteration rhythm of the version, and helps developers complete the version iterative optimization and compatibility testing faster through the version compatibility adaptation guide, remote real machine, and OTalk developers to communicate online . In particular, the remote real machine has made great contributions, allowing developers to remotely debug the upgraded application, conduct multi-scenario testing and experience in the Android 12 environment, check compatibility, flashback, bugs and other issues as soon as possible, and help developers complete the preliminary adaptation test work online.
OPPO's account service is born to solve the user authentication problems that plague developers, and it supports users of application developers to log in with OPPO accounts on their mobile phones. At this year's OPPO Developer Conference, it was disclosed that the number of monthly active users of ColorOS in 2021 was 460 million+, an increase of nearly 100 million compared with the 370 million+ monthly active users in 2020. This means that by using OPPO account services, developers can take advantage of OPPO's continuous growth of massive users to bring rich user resources to themselves. More importantly, users of the application can quickly, securely and conveniently log in to the application without re-registration, and in the case of user authorization, the OPPO account can also provide the user's relevant information to help developers improve user information.
Therefore, the OPPO mobile service platform does subtraction for developers, and developers can no longer worry about development adaptation, but focus on more important things.
Multiplication: How can operational efficiency achieve a multiplier effect?
Application development is only the first step in the long march, and how to operate the application well is the top priority.
In this regard, the OPPO mobile service platform is to do "multiplication" for developers, through push services, data services, game services, wallet services and other services, so that developers' operational efficiency is doubled.
Push service is a typical example, a developer commented: "After we accessed the push capability, we covered more than 200,000 users, and the arrival rate of each message push reached about 99%. ”
OPPO's push service has four major advantages: efficient distribution, bringing million-level message push rate per second, the arrival rate reaches more than 99%; system-level channel, sharing ColorOS system-level long connection, service stability, to ensure the high arrival rate of messages; fast integration, SDK package body of about 20K, client integration is fast and simple; convenient and easy to use, providing two operational push methods of Web platform and API, effectively improving retention rate.
It is precisely because of so many advantages that the OPPO push service has been favored by many developers. According to Han Hui, the push service is also constantly upgrading, and developers can label users according to their own product attributes and carry out accurate push. OPPO push service also provides a variety of presentation means such as long text, customized icons, and large pictures to enhance the attractiveness of users and enhance conversion rates.
Game services are the services that game developers prefer, and provide one-stop access services for game developers through comprehensive ability support such as account, payment, and data analysis.
It is worth noting that OPPO game services pay special attention to the mining of game content, and increase the attractiveness of games to users through the full-scenario distribution of content. On September 12, the game was launched, with a cumulative reservation of 1.4 million on the OPPO platform before its launch, and a download volume of 1.7 million on the day of launch, becoming the first Android omni-channel reservation and the first new one. Behind such a hot, there is a reason for the content to "break the circle". OPPO converts the game content of "New Tomb Robber Notes" into scene content, and uses the lock screen of open screen and instant view, browsers with high frequency of use, popular videos and OPPO communities to promote users in all scenarios, and uses content to stimulate the empathy of "Tomb Robber Notes" fans, capturing many users.
It can be seen that the OPPO mobile service platform brings multiplication effects to developers through these services, so as to make operational efficiency more powerful.
Division: Remove barriers on the road to monetization
In this regard, OPPO mobile services bring developers the empowerment of advertising services, payment services, etc., eliminate obstacles on the road to monetization, and help developers do "division".
The most impressive thing about the author is the advertising service. With oppo advertising services, developers can rely on OPPO's big data accurate crowd analysis capabilities and a large number of high-quality advertisers to achieve commercial monetization through rich advertising styles. According to Li Jiuyan, product operation manager of OPPO Advertising Alliance, oppo advertising alliance daily request level has exceeded 5 billion, DAU coverage of more than 200 million, the number of cooperative media more than 12,000, the number of cooperative advertisers more than 30,000.
At the OPPO Developer Conference, a developer author talked about the feeling of accessing OPPO advertising services: "We accessed the advertising alliance, under the guidance of the official help document, the entire access process is very smooth, in a very short period of time to complete the process from permission application to APP listing, the realization of the product after access is also unexpectedly good." ”
It is worth noting that OPPO advertising services are also constantly evolving. For example, OPPO has added a mixing strategy to the SDK, that is, for the same ad slot, when a request is made, it can return both image ads and video ads, and mix image ads and video ads for a mixed auction, so that the result can be to maximize the value of each ad exposure. Another example is the upgrade of advertising styles, adding interactive ads to bring users an immersive advertising experience and promote accurate conversion.
There are many such examples. What the author feels most deeply is that OPPO advertising services not only pursue the maximization of advertising effects, but also pay attention to the balance of user experience. For example, native template ads are used in mini games to purify the access ecology and improve the user experience.
Postscript: Everywhere, interlocking
Looking at the evolving OPPO mobile service platform, it can be summarized into three words: one-stop, full-link, and multi-scenario.
"One-stop": OPPO mobile service platform brings together OPPO's multi-scenario open technology capabilities, multi-channel channel resource advantages and all-round service support, which can be called a one-stop open capability aggregation platform and a one-stop service platform for developers.
"Full link": OPPO mobile service platform services for developers, covering the application development, new pull, retention, monetization, performance optimization and other full links, it can be said that in the whole life cycle of the application can continue to bring empowerment. One developer's description is apt: "I can always feel the presence of OPPO, and the continuous support, is 'everywhere, interlocking.'" ”
"Multi-scenario": Oppo mobile service platform is not limited to mobile phone scenarios, but also looks at multi-terminal and multi-scenario. Han Hui revealed that with the development of OPPO's multi-terminal ecosystem, the mobile service platform will use services for more terminal scenarios.
At the OPPO Developer Conference, Liu Chang, president of OPPO Research Institute, proposed the next generation of dynamic energy formula: N.E.PE=[T (S + O)]i (Next Ecological Potential Energy, N.E.PE), which defines the role and relationship between developers and platforms, and shows the huge potential energy that can be brought about by the integration and co-creation of both parties.
Among them, OPPO mobile services play a heavy role in the integration and co-creation of platforms and developers, through the comprehensive empowerment of developers, let developers focus on what they are good at, bring users high-quality applications, excellent experiences, and jointly bring together the next generation of life, and better move towards the era of "mutual integration of all things".
This also corresponds to the theme of this year's OPPO Developer Conference: "Openness and Mutual Integration, Good Innovation".